Home
last modified time | relevance | path

Searched refs:movsd (Results 1 – 25 of 177) sorted by relevance

12345678

/external/llvm/test/CodeGen/X86/
Dlsr-static-addr.ll5 ; CHECK: movsd .LCPI0_0(%rip), %xmm0
8 ; CHECK-NEXT: movsd A(,%rax,8)
10 ; CHECK-NEXT: movsd
14 ; ATOM: movsd .LCPI0_0(%rip), %xmm0
18 ; ATOM-NEXT: movsd A(,%rax,8)
20 ; ATOM-NEXT: movsd
Dmemcpy-2.ll15 ; SSE2-Darwin: movsd _.str+16, %xmm0
16 ; SSE2-Darwin: movsd %xmm0, 16(%esp)
22 ; SSE2-Mingw32: movsd _.str+16, %xmm0
23 ; SSE2-Mingw32: movsd %xmm0, 16(%esp)
96 ; SSE2-Darwin: movsd (%ecx), %xmm0
97 ; SSE2-Darwin: movsd 8(%ecx), %xmm1
98 ; SSE2-Darwin: movsd %xmm1, 8(%eax)
99 ; SSE2-Darwin: movsd %xmm0, (%eax)
102 ; SSE2-Mingw32: movsd (%ecx), %xmm0
103 ; SSE2-Mingw32: movsd 8(%ecx), %xmm1
[all …]
Dlower-bitcast.ll16 ; CHECK-NOT: movsd
23 ; CHECK-WIDE-NOT: movsd
36 ; CHECK-NOT: movsd
41 ; CHECK-WIDE-NOT: movsd
113 ; CHECK-NOT: movsd
134 ; CHECK-NOT: movsd
140 ; CHECK-WIDE-NOT: movsd
157 ; CHECK-NOT: movsd
164 ; CHECK-WIDE-NOT: movsd
178 ; CHECK-NOT: movsd
[all …]
Dpr3154.ll32 …call void asm sideeffect "movsd $0, %xmm7 \0A\09movapd ff_pd_1, %xmm6 \0…
84movsd ff_pd_1, %xmm0 \0A\09movsd ff_pd_1, %xmm1 \0A\09movsd ff_pd_1, %xmm2 \0A\091: …
92movsd ff_pd_1, %xmm0 \0A\09movsd ff_pd_1, %xmm1 \0A\091: \0A…
Dstack-align.ll26 ; CHECK: movsd {{.*}}G, %xmm{{.*}}
28 ; CHECK: movsd 4(%esp), %xmm{{.*}}
79 ; CHECK: movsd
80 ; CHECK-NEXT: movsd
81 ; CHECK-NEXT: movsd
82 ; CHECK-NEXT: movsd
Di64-mem-copy.ll5 ; Use movq or movsd to load / store i64 values if sse2 is available.
19 ; X32-NEXT: movsd {{.*#+}} xmm0 = mem[0],zero
20 ; X32-NEXT: movsd %xmm0, (%eax)
71 ; X32: movsd {{.*#+}} xmm0 = mem[0],zero
72 ; X32-NEXT: movsd %xmm0, (%eax)
Dvselect-2.ll8 ; SSE2-NEXT: movsd {{.*#+}} xmm1 = xmm0[0],xmm1[1]
23 ; SSE2-NEXT: movsd {{.*#+}} xmm0 = xmm1[0],xmm0[1]
37 ; SSE2-NEXT: movsd {{.*#+}} xmm1 = xmm0[0],xmm1[1]
52 ; SSE2-NEXT: movsd {{.*#+}} xmm0 = xmm1[0],xmm0[1]
Dvolatile.ll1 ; RUN: llc < %s -march=x86 -mattr=sse2 | grep movsd | count 5
2 ; RUN: llc < %s -march=x86 -mattr=sse2 -O0 | grep -v esp | grep movsd | count 5
Dsse-fcopysign.ll29 ; X32: movsd {{.*#+}} xmm0 = mem[0],zero
33 ; X32-NEXT: movsd %xmm0, (%esp)
34 ; X32-NEXT: movsd %xmm1, 8(%esp)
81 ; X32-NEXT: movsd 8(%ebp), %xmm1 {{.*#+}} xmm1 = mem[0],zero
125 ; X64: movsd .LCPI5_0(%rip), %xmm0 {{.*#+}} xmm0 = mem[0],zero
Drip-rel-address.ll12 ; PIC64: movsd _a(%rip), %xmm0
13 ; STATIC64: movsd a(%rip), %xmm0
Dlsr-reuse.ll12 ; CHECK: movsd (%rsi), %xmm0
14 ; CHECK: movsd %xmm0, (%rdi)
54 ; CHECK: movsd -2048(%rsi), %xmm0
56 ; CHECK: movsd %xmm0, -2048(%rdi)
57 ; CHECK: movsd (%rsi), %xmm0
59 ; CHECK: movsd %xmm0, (%rdi)
100 ; CHECK: movsd (%rsi), %xmm0
102 ; CHECK: movsd %xmm0, (%rdi)
103 ; CHECK: movsd -2048(%rsi), %xmm0
105 ; CHECK: movsd %xmm0, -2048(%rdi)
[all …]
Dlower-vec-shift.ll35 ; SSE-NEXT: movsd
67 ; SSE-NEXT: movsd
87 ; SSE-NEXT: movsd
119 ; SSE-NEXT: movsd
/external/swiftshader/third_party/LLVM/test/CodeGen/X86/
Dpr3154.ll32 …call void asm sideeffect "movsd $0, %xmm7 \0A\09movapd ff_pd_1, %xmm6 \0…
84movsd ff_pd_1, %xmm0 \0A\09movsd ff_pd_1, %xmm1 \0A\09movsd ff_pd_1, %xmm2 \0A\091: …
92movsd ff_pd_1, %xmm0 \0A\09movsd ff_pd_1, %xmm1 \0A\091: \0A…
Dlsr-static-addr.ll4 ; CHECK: movsd .LCPI0_0(%rip), %xmm0
7 ; CHECK-NEXT: movsd A(,%rax,8)
9 ; CHECK-NEXT: movsd
Dvec_set-8.ll3 ; CHECK-NOT: movsd
5 ; CHECK-NOT: movsd
Dlsr-reuse.ll11 ; CHECK: movsd (%rsi), %xmm0
13 ; CHECK: movsd %xmm0, (%rdi)
53 ; CHECK: movsd -2048(%rsi), %xmm0
55 ; CHECK: movsd %xmm0, -2048(%rdi)
56 ; CHECK: movsd (%rsi), %xmm0
58 ; CHECK: movsd %xmm0, (%rdi)
99 ; CHECK: movsd (%rsi), %xmm0
101 ; CHECK: movsd %xmm0, (%rdi)
102 ; CHECK: movsd -2048(%rsi), %xmm0
104 ; CHECK: movsd %xmm0, -2048(%rdi)
[all …]
Dvolatile.ll1 ; RUN: llc < %s -march=x86 -mattr=sse2 | grep movsd | count 5
2 ; RUN: llc < %s -march=x86 -mattr=sse2 -O0 | grep -v esp | grep movsd | count 5
Drip-rel-address.ll12 ; PIC64: movsd _a(%rip), %xmm0
13 ; STATIC64: movsd a(%rip), %xmm0
Di64-mem-copy.ll6 ; X32: movsd (%eax), %xmm
8 ; Uses movsd to load / store i64 values if sse2 is available.
/external/swiftshader/third_party/subzero/tests_lit/llvm2ice_tests/
Dfp.load_store.ll45 ; CHECK: movsd
76 ; CHECK: movsd
77 ; CHECK: movsd
112 ; CHECK: movsd
113 ; CHECK: movsd
/external/v8/src/crankshaft/ia32/
Dlithium-gap-resolver-ia32.cc309 __ movsd(dst, Operand(esp, 0)); in EmitMove() local
334 __ movsd(dst, src); in EmitMove() local
342 __ movsd(dst, src); in EmitMove() local
346 __ movsd(xmm0, src); in EmitMove() local
347 __ movsd(dst, xmm0); in EmitMove() local
430 __ movsd(xmm0, other); in EmitSwap() local
431 __ movsd(other, reg); in EmitSwap() local
442 __ movsd(xmm0, dst0); // Save destination in xmm0. in EmitSwap() local
447 __ movsd(src0, xmm0); in EmitSwap() local
/external/llvm/test/MC/ELF/
Dmerge.s7 movsd .Lfoo(%rip), %xmm1
13 movsd .Lfoo+4(%rip), %xmm1
/external/compiler-rt/lib/builtins/i386/
Dfloatdidf.S30 movsd REL_ADDR(twop52), %xmm2 // 0x1.0p52
34 movsd %xmm0, 4(%esp)
Dfloatundixf.S36 movsd %xmm1, 4(%esp)
38 movsd %xmm0, 4(%esp)
Dfloatundisf.S87 movsd STICKY, %xmm1 // (big input) ? 0xfff : 0
92 movsd TWOp52, %xmm2 // 0x1.0p52

12345678